Rick Santorum Quote

I reject that number completely, that people die in America because of lack of health insurance. People die in America because people die in America. And people make poor decisions with respect to their health and their healthcare. And they don't go to the emergency room or they don't go to the doctor when they need to.


Badash, David (6 December 2011), "Santorum: No One Has Ever Died Because They Didn't Have Health Care", The New Civil Rights Movement
